ویژگی تصویر

آموزش دستور ARP در CMD

  /  CMD   /  دستور ARP در CMD
بنر تبلیغاتی الف

دستور ARP (Address Resolution Protocol) در محیط CMD (Command Prompt) ابزاری قدرتمند برای مدیریت و بازرسی جداول ARP در سیستم‌های عامل Windows است. این دستور به ما اجازه می‌دهد تا اطلاعات مربوط به ترکیب آدرس IP و MAC را مشاهده کنیم، یا حتی تغییر دهیم.

مفاهیم پایه ARP

ARP یک پروتکل شبکه است که در لایه ارتباطی (Data Link Layer) قرار دارد. هدف آن، تبدیل آدرس IP به آدرس MAC در شبکه‌های محلی (LAN) است.

نحوه استفاده از دستور ARP در CMD

برای استفاده از دستور ARP در CMD، می‌توانید از گزینه‌های مختلف آن استفاده کنید. در ادامه، به بررسی بیشتر این دستور می‌پردازیم.

دستور ARP و نحوه استفاده از آن

در CMD، دستور ARP به صورت زیر است:

arp -a

این دستور تمامی موارد موجود در جدول ARP را نمایش می‌دهد. مثلاً می‌توانید اطلاعات دستگاه‌های متصل به شبکه را مشاهده کنید.

arp -d 192.168.1.100

این دستور، ورودی مربوط به IP 192.168.1.100 را از جدول ARP حذف می‌کند.

پارامترهای مهم دستور ARP

برخی از پارامترهای مفید در دستور ARP عبارتند از:

  • -a: نمایش تمامی موارد موجود در جدول ARP
  • -d: حذف ورودی خاص از جدول ARP
  • -s: افزودن ورودی جدید به جدول ARP

نمونه‌های عملی

در ادامه، چند نمونه کاربردی از دستور ARP را ملاحظه می‌کنید:

مشاهده جدول ARP

با استفاده از دستور زیر، می‌توانید تمامی موارد موجود در جدول ARP را مشاهده کنید:

arp -a

خروجی این دستور به صورت زیر خواهد بود:

IP AddressPhysical AddressType
192.168.1.100-1A-2B-3C-4D-5Estatic
192.168.1.10000-2B-3C-4D-5E-6Fdynamic

در این جدول، می‌توانید ببینید که آدرس IP 192.168.1.1 با آدرس MAC 00-1A-2B-3C-4D-5E مرتبط است.

حذف ورودی از جدول ARP

برای حذف یک ورودی خاص، از دستور زیر استفاده کنید:

arp -d 192.168.1.100

در این دستور، ورودی مربوط به IP 192.168.1.100 از جدول ARP حذف می‌شود.

افزودن ورودی جدید به جدول ARP

برای افزودن یک ورودی جدید، از دستور زیر استفاده کنید:

arp -s 192.168.1.200 00-3C-4D-5E-6F-7A

در این دستور، ورودی جدید با IP 192.168.1.200 و MAC 00-3C-4D-5E-6F-7A به جدول ARP اضافه می‌شود.

نکات مهم در استفاده از دستور ARP

برای استفاده مؤثر از دستور ARP، باید به نکات زیر توجه کنید:

  • دستور ARP فقط در محیط CMD با دسترسی مدیر (Admin) قابل اجرا است.
  • دستور -s برای افزودن ورودی‌های ثابت به جدول ARP مناسب است.
  • در صورتی که IP مورد نظر دارای چندین MAC باشد، ممکن است اطلاعات نادرست نمایش داده شود.

خطاهای رایج و رفع آنها

در زمان استفاده از دستور ARP، بعضی از خطاهای رایج وجود دارند:

  • Access Denied: معمولاً به دلیل عدم دسترسی مدیریتی است. باید CMD را با دسترسی مدیر اجرا کنید.
  • Invalid parameter: این خطا زمانی ظاهر می‌شود که پارامترهای داده شده صحیح نباشند.

بهترین روش‌ها در استفاده از ARP

برای استفاده بهینه از دستور ARP، باید به موارد زیر توجه کنید:

  • در صورت نیاز به ارتباط با دستگاه‌های خاص، از دستور -s برای ثبت آدرس MAC و IP مناسب است.
  • برای امنیت شبکه، باید دقت کنید که ورودی‌های ARP معتبر باشند.

نتیجه‌گیری

دستور ARP در CMD یک ابزار قدرتمند برای مدیریت شبکه و دسترسی به اطلاعات MAC/IP است. با استفاده از آن، می‌توانید جداول ARP را مشاهده، تغییر دهید یا حذف کنید. در هر صورت، باید با دقت و دسترسی مناسب از آن استفاده کنید.

آیا این مطلب برای شما مفید بود ؟

خیر
بله
موضوعات شما در انجمن: